The criteria for selecting an Op is highly subjective and is often a matter of personal opinion. However, various qualities you will find in most of our Ops will give you an idea what is needed.
So, here are some pointers on what it takes to become a junior (below 400) OP (Operator) on IRC (Internet Relay Chat) Undernet's Channel #Dubai.
Start by asking yourself: "Would I still be in #Dubai if I were not an OP there."
If you can answer "YES," then read on ...
- A regular on IRChat and a regular in the channel #Dubai on Undernet
- Is supportive of the channel
- Does not support channels and others that Flood and disrupt #Dubai (added 3/May/01)
- Has not in the past Flooded and disrupted #Dubai with malice (added 3/May/01)
- Has not been abusive to Regulars and Ops of the channel with the intent of continued malice (added 3/May/01)
- Talks to people, especially new visitors in the channel
- Is helpful, friendly and kind
- Allows other's to air their views without being overly sensitive to criticism
- Is tolerant and doesn't resort to retribution or revenge
- Knows and follows the channel Rules
- Knows and follows the OPs Guidelines (added 3/May/01)
- Doesn't want Ops for ego status and doesn't allow it to go to their head
- Doesn't make having OPs the reason for them being in #Dubai (added 3/May/01)
- Doesn't invite people to #Dubai by promising them OP status (added 31/Oct/00)
- Doesn't invite people from #Dubai, trying to promote their other channel(s) (added 3/May/01)
- Doesn't keep asking repeatedly for Ops - taking up so much of the Ops time and energy by doing so (added 3/May/01)
- Doesn't take offense or demand reasons after reasons when not given OPs (added 3/May/01)
- Doesn't mass invite people into #Dubai (added 31/Oct)
- Knows some of the regulars in the channel
- Knows most of the regular Ops
- Knows most of the Senior Ops (400+)
- Is respected and liked by most people in the channel (added 3/May/01)
- Is a regular reader of #Dubai web pages and contributes to them in some way (added 3/May/01)
- Knows how to ban and kick a person
- Knows how to unban and invite a person (including through X)
- Knows how to voice and devoice a person (added 3/May/01)
- Knows about the different Levels of OP you can be (1-500)
- Knows how to use the Bot X - though doesn't have to be a technical expert
- Should not be an Etisalat employee or agent or represent them in any way :)

Guidelines for Ops in #Dubai
Ops don't kick or de-op each other
This is a rule with a bit of elasticity. Obviously if it is some sort of joke between the Ops, it is not a problem. If an Op's script goes crazy, or the Op is away and their script is interfering with channel operation or other Ops, you may have to kick or de-op another Op until the matter can be resolved. By the same token your own script may auto-kick or auto-de-op an Op during certain events or due to an action. If so, please correct or disable it. The point to this is that you are NOT to use your status as an op to interfere with other ops. It gives the channel a bad image, and creates discord in channel.Ops don't ban each other
This is a rule which should not be broken unless there is a serious breach causing disruption in the channel. (added 3/May/01)Ops: Don't abuse your ops privileges
As well as the abuses listed above, Ops don't abuse the users by kicking or banning users as a joke or for personal or trivial reasons. A lot of users consider Ops as only privilege, with no consideration of the responsibilities, and are envious of the status. Lording it over them doesn't help. By the same token, a lot of users consider any criticism of them or their behavior to be a personal or trivial attack, and an abuse of Ops. Try not to give them an excuse to claim abuse, but don't bend over backwards tolerating trash from them. Use your own judgment and count on the other Ops to support you. Some people will claim abuse no matter how fair you are.Ops: Don't wash #Dubai laundry in the open channel
Matters pertaining to misunderstandings between Ops and administration disputes of #Dubai or the Dubaichat WebPages must be discussed outside the channel.Giving Courtesy Ops
Giving Ops to non-voted-in ops can cause a lot of trouble. Many scripts people use have backdoors that allow people to control the channel through the Op'd persons client. This has happened twice before and caused major headaches. You can op another regular user, but you will be responsible. Please ensure they at least know the common rules of our channel, and de-op them immediately on any sign of abuse or trouble. Please also do not object if another regular Ops wants to de-op the person.Inviting friends promising them OP
Doing this causes a lot of problems. Ops in X are for regulars who support the channel and enjoy being in it because they want to be. Not because they have Ops. No one should get Ops in X until they are both regular and fulfil the criteria set out here.Bans set by an Op in X
Bans in X should be specific when possible and not by site or domain unless absolutely necessary. They should also list a valid reason for the ban. Other Ops should really not lift a ban set in X without knowing first the reason it was set, and preferably discussing the matter with the person who set the ban.The hierarchy of Ops
This can basically followed by the Access level of the Op in X. Usually Ops will defer to Ops that are longtime IRCers, or persons of particular expertise on various subject, or persons whose personal opinion the particular Op happens to respect. Additionally, some Ops are on more than others, and by this are more often involved, informed, and available for consultation. This is a natural deference, and determined on an individual basis. Basically the hierarchy follows the pattern of 450+, 400+, and 400-.others.#Dubai is not a script-testing channel
#Dubai basically allows some big colorful popups and fancy greeting motifs. It is not however a captive audience for people who join the channel and unload their ASCII art files. Nor is the channel open for experimental scripts testing. The "sorry I just got this script, didn't realize the popups spewed profanity and insults" excuse isn't acceptable. Users should test a new script in an empty channel. We will not accept clones, Bots, obscene and insulting popups, multiple trout-slapping, one-man ASCII artshows, wav-floods, and weapons or script testing.Buggy Scripts
Similarly, if your scripts are buggy, and kick/ban people when they shouldn't be, de-op yourself and fix your scripts. Don't be surprised, and don't bother to act offended, if you find yourself suspended when you are seen to be causing problems because of your faulty or overly sensitive scripts.Lag
Don't be too quick on the kick. The person who appears to be offensive may not be in synch and may need more than a second or two before they see your warning. Allow for response time. Ping them if they just sit there. Then kick 'em.
